variable "inbound_endpoints" {
type = map(object({
name = optional(string)
subnet_name = string
private_ip_allocation_method = optional(string, "Dynamic")
private_ip_address = optional(string, null)
}))
default = {}
description = <<DESCRIPTION
A map of inbound endpoints to create on this resource.
Multiple endpoints can be created by providing multiple entries in the map.
For each endpoint, the `subnet_name` is required, it points to a subnet in the virtual network provided in the "virtual_network_resource_id" variable.
DESCRIPTION
}
variable "lock" {
type = object({
kind = string
name = optional(string, null)
})
default = null
description = <<DESCRIPTION
Controls the Resource Lock configuration for this resource. The following properties can be specified:
- `kind` - (Required) The type of lock. Possible values are `\"CanNotDelete\"` and `\"ReadOnly\"`.
- `name` - (Optional) The name of the lock. If not specified, a name will be generated based on the `kind` value. Changing this forces the creation of a new resource.
DESCRIPTION
validation {
condition = var.lock != null ? contains(["CanNotDelete", "ReadOnly"], var.lock.kind) : true
error_message = "Lock kind must be either `\"CanNotDelete\"` or `\"ReadOnly\"`."
}
}
# The outbound_endpoints variable is an object that allows creating outbound endpoints and related resources such as forwarding rulesets, rules and virtual network links
# This is done in a hierarchial manner to best describe the relationship between the resources
# The provider objects are broken down into lists in the locals.tf file to allow creation of the resources
variable "outbound_endpoints" {
type = map(object({
name = optional(string)
subnet_name = string
forwarding_ruleset = optional(map(object({
name = optional(string)
link_with_outbound_endpoint_virtual_network = optional(bool, true)
metadata_for_outbound_endpoint_virtual_network_link = optional(map(string), null)
additional_virtual_network_links = optional(map(object({
name = optional(string)
vnet_id = string
metadata = optional(map(string), null)
})), {})
rules = optional(map(object({
name = optional(string)
domain_name = string
destination_ip_addresses = map(string)
enabled = optional(bool, true)
metadata = optional(map(string), null)
})))
})))
}))
default = {}
description = <<DESCRIPTION
A map of outbound endpoints to create on this resource.
- `name` - (Optional) The name for the endpoint
- `link_with_outbound_endpoint_virtual_network` - (Optional) Whether to link the outbound endpoint with the virtual network. Defaults to true.
- `metadata_for_outbound_endpoint_virtual_network_link` - (Optional) A map of metadata to associate with the virtual network link.
- `additional_virtual_network_links` - (Optional) A map of additional virtual network links to create.
- `vnet_id` - (Required) The ID of the virtual network to link to.
- `metadata` - (Optional) A map of metadata to associate with the virtual network link.
- `subnet_name` - (Required) The subnet name from the virtual network provided.
- `forwarding_ruleset` - (Optional) A map of forwarding rulesets to create on the outbound endpoint.
- `name` - (Optional) The name of the forwarding ruleset
- `rules` - (Optional) A map of forwarding rules to create on the forwarding ruleset.
- `name` - (Optional) The name of the forwarding rule
- `domain_name` - (Required) The domain name to forward
- `enabled` - (Optional) Whether the forwarding rule is enabled. Defaults to true.
- `metadata` - (Optional) A map of metadata to associate with the forwarding rule
- `destination_ip_addresses` - (Required) a map of string, the key is the IP address and the value is the port
DESCRIPTION
nullable = false
}
variable "role_assignments" {
type = map(object({
role_definition_id_or_name = string
principal_id = string
description = optional(string, null)
skip_service_principal_aad_check = optional(bool, false)
condition = optional(string, null)
condition_version = optional(string, null)
delegated_managed_identity_resource_id = optional(string, null)
principal_type = optional(string, null)
}))
default = {}
description = <<DESCRIPTION
A map of role assignments to create on the <RESOURCE>. The map key is deliberately arbitrary to avoid issues where map keys maybe unknown at plan time.
- `role_definition_id_or_name` - The ID or name of the role definition to assign to the principal.
- `principal_id` - The ID of the principal to assign the role to.
- `description` - (Optional) The description of the role assignment.
- `skip_service_principal_aad_check` - (Optional) If set to true, skips the Azure Active Directory check for the service principal in the tenant. Defaults to false.
- `condition` - (Optional) The condition which will be used to scope the role assignment.
- `condition_version` - (Optional) The version of the condition syntax. Leave as `null` if you are not using a condition, if you are then valid values are '2.0'.
- `delegated_managed_identity_resource_id` - (Optional) The delegated Azure Resource Id which contains a Managed Identity. Changing this forces a new resource to be created. This field is only used in cross-tenant scenario.
- `principal_type` - (Optional) The type of the `principal_id`. Possible values are `User`, `Group` and `ServicePrincipal`. It is necessary to explicitly set this attribute when creating role assignments if the principal creating the assignment is constrained by ABAC rules that filters on the PrincipalType attribute.
> Note: only set `skip_service_principal_aad_check` to true if you are assigning a role to a service principal.
DESCRIPTION
nullable = false
}
